Virginia "Ginny" Blackmore (born March 6, 1986 in Auckland ) is a New Zealand singer and songwriter.
biography
At 16, Ginny Blackmore dropped out of school to become a singer. Daniel Bedingfield , who found her online, supported her and also helped her when she moved to London at 19 . With the help of a demo tape she came to a contract with Sony Music . At first she only wrote songs for other artists like Christina Aguilera and Adam Lambert . After five years in England, she moved to Los Angeles and got her own record deal with Epic Records in 2011 after auditioning at LA Reid .
With her first single Bones she had a number one hit with platinum status in her home country . In the USA, it made it into the adult pop songs charts. Her second single SFM had previously been recorded by Christina Aguilera under the title Sing for Me .
